Measure Length with a Ruler

  1. Identify the starting point
    Place the ruler so the object’s left end or starting mark lines up with 0. Measuring from 0 avoids extra subtraction.

  2. Read the ending point carefully
    Look straight down at the mark where the object ends. The number at that mark gives the length, along with the ruler’s unit.

  3. Use the correct unit
    If the ruler shows inches, write the answer in inches; if it shows centimeters, write the answer in centimeters. Keep the unit in the final answer.

  4. Simplify the answer if needed
    If the result is a fraction, reduce it when possible. For example, write an equivalent simpler fraction if the answer is not already in lowest terms.

Check your work

  • Make sure the ruler started at 0.
  • Make sure you read the mark at the end of the object, not the line before or after it.
  • Confirm the final answer is written with the correct unit and is simplified.

If the object does not start at 0, measure the distance between the two marks by subtracting the starting reading from the ending reading.
